Bolidea (@bolidea and @alexdao) are organizing and hosting next tuesday Usability Fix. The 2 hour long session aims to find issues in your application’s interface, with users going through the application and giving valuable feedback to the designers and developers of the application.

I went to a previous usability fix event; it’s funny to see developers discovering that their users didn’t have a clue what their application was about, or let alone know how to finish a user action.
